Impondrías
Impondrías is the second-person singular conditional form of the Spanish verb "imponer." The verb "imponer" generally means to impose, to enforce, to command, or to impress. Therefore, "impondrías" translates to "you would impose," "you would enforce," "you would command," or "you would impress," depending on the context of the sentence.
